WebMust, can't and couldn't + infinitive are used to express deductions about present events: That child is really talented. His parents must be proud of him. It's only 10 o'clock. He can't/couldn't be at home. Past Must, can't and couldn't + perfect infinitive are used to … WebIn English, there are several modal verbs of deduction. They allow us to guess if something is true based on the information available. Four very important ones to know are must, can’t, may (not), and might (not).
